In recent years, we've witnessed a resurgence of interest in the world of geometric shapes and forms, especially in the United States. This trend is driven by the increasing awareness of the interconnectedness of art, mathematics, and science. As we navigate the complexities of modern life, the concept of geometric shapes and forms is gaining attention as a tool for personal growth, creativity, and problem-solving.

So, what exactly is the language of geometric shapes and forms? At its core, it's a system of communication that uses geometric shapes and forms to convey meaning and express ideas. This language is based on a set of basic shapes, such as points, lines, angles, and planes, which can be combined in various ways to create more complex forms.
